How to choose the right beam spot moving head for your venue?
1. How do beam spot moving head lights differ from other moving head fixtures?
Beam spot moving head lights are specialized fixtures designed to produce narrow, high-intensity beams that cut through atmospheric effects like haze or fog. Unlike wash moving heads, which provide broad, soft-edged illumination, beam spot fixtures focus on creating sharp, focused beams ideal for aerial effects and long-throw applications. They are commonly used in large venues such as concerts and festivals to create dramatic visual effects.
2. What are the key specifications to consider when selecting a beam spot moving head light?
When choosing a beam spot moving head light, consider the following specifications:
Light Source: LED-based fixtures offer longer lifespans (approximately 50,000 hours) and lower maintenance compared to discharge lamps.
Beam Angle: Narrow beam angles (1°–6°) are typical for beam fixtures, providing tight, intense beams suitable for long-throw effects.
Optical Quality: High-quality optics ensure sharp, well-defined beams.
Movement Range: A pan range of 540° and a tilt range of 270° allow for versatile positioning.
Control Protocols: Ensure compatibility with standard control protocols like DMX512, RDM, Art-Net, or sACN for seamless integration.
3. How does the choice of light source impact the performance and maintenance of beam spot moving head lights?
The light source significantly affects both performance and maintenance:
LED Fixtures: Offer instant on/off capabilities, energy efficiency, and a longer operational life (~50,000 hours). They require less maintenance and provide consistent color mixing.
Discharge Lamps: Provide higher initial brightness but have shorter lifespans (2,000–4,000 hours) and require regular replacement, leading to higher maintenance costs.
4. What are the considerations for beam angle selection in beam spot moving head lights?
Selecting the appropriate beam angle is crucial:
Narrow Beam Angles (1°–6°): Ideal for long-throw applications and creating visible beams in the air, especially when used with haze or fog.
Wider Beam Angles: Suitable for mid-range projections but may not produce the same dramatic aerial effects.
5. How do control protocols and connectivity affect the integration of beam spot moving head lights into a lighting system?
Control protocols and connectivity are vital for system integration:
DMX512: The most common protocol, allowing for control of multiple fixtures.
RDM (Remote Device Management): Enables two-way communication for monitoring and configuration.
Art-Net and sACN: Network-based protocols suitable for large-scale installations.
Ensure the chosen fixture supports the desired protocol for seamless operation.
6. What maintenance practices are essential for ensuring the longevity and optimal performance of beam spot moving head lights?
Regular maintenance practices include:
Cleaning: Regularly clean optics and fans to prevent dust buildup, which can affect performance.
Inspection: Periodically check for mechanical issues such as loose components or signs of wear.
Firmware Updates: Keep the fixture's firmware updated to ensure compatibility with control systems and to access new features.
Lamp Replacement: For discharge lamp fixtures, replace lamps as needed based on usage hours to maintain optimal brightness.
